Marine Life Encounters
Charleston's waters are home to Atlantic bottlenose dolphins, and spotting these playful creatures often becomes the highlight of bachelor and bachelorette cruises. These intelligent mammals are curious about boats and frequently swim alongside, sometimes putting on a show with jumps and tail slaps. They're most active during incoming tides and can be seen year-round, though summer months offer the best viewing opportunities. Dolphins travel in pods, so where you see one, others usually follow. Brown pelicans are another crowd-pleaser, especially when they perform their signature dive-bombing fishing technique. These large seabirds cruise just above the water's surface before suddenly plunging down to snatch fish. They're fearless around boats and often land on dock pilings or channel markers, posing like they know they're being photographed. Summer brings the most activity as young pelicans learn to fish, creating entertaining aerial displays.
